Recipes and Cooking Broccoli-Potato Soup with Greens 4.2 (19) Add your rating & review This easy recipe for broccoli soup is speedy enough--and fiiling enough--for a quick lunch. Potatoes add extra heartiness, while the winter greens add flavor and color. Bring to boiling; reduce heat. Simmer, covered, for 8 minutes. Mash slightly. Add broccoli and milk; bring just to simmering. In a medium bowl toss flour with the 2 cups cheese; gradually add to soup, stirring cheese until melted. Season to taste with pepper. Ladle soup into shallow serving bowls. Top with greens and additional cheese.
